CVE-2023-23594
An authentication bypass vulnerability in the web client interface for the CL4NX printer before firmware version 1.13.3-u724r2 provides remote unauthenticated attackers with access to execute commands intended only for valid/authenticated users, such as file uploads and configuration changes...

CVE-2022-24673
Canon imageCLASS MF644Cdw 10.02 printers are affected by CVE-2022-24673 due to a stack-based buffer overflow in the SLP protocol implementation, allowing remote, unauthenticated code execution as root.
